Starbucks Will Allow Baristas to Wear Black Lives Matter Attire Amid Backlash

Reading now: 631
justjared.com

Starbucks is now making it known that baristas can support the Black Lives Matter movement with their attire.

The chain coffee company confirmed on Friday (June 12) that workers would be allowed to wear clothing and accessories in support of BLM, following backlash and calls for boycotts for their initial internal messaging.

In a memo obtained by BuzzFeed News Wednesday (June 10), Starbucks had initially prohibited baristas and employees from wearing T-shirts, pins, or any other accessory that mentioned Black Lives Matter, saying that such items could be misunderstood and incite violence.
